3 bucket system for catering?

The three bucket system is a safe-handling practice for cleaning dishes in catering and restaurants. The first sink is filled with hot, soapy water. The dishes are washed in this sink. The second sink has clean, clear rinse water. After the dishes are rinsed, they are rinsed again in the third sink that contains sanitizer.

What is the purpose of a plumbing tailpiece and how does it contribute to the overall functionality of a sink system?

A plumbing tailpiece is a pipe that connects the sink drain to the P-trap, allowing water to flow out of the sink and into the drainage system. It helps to maintain proper drainage and prevent clogs by guiding water away from the sink and into the sewer system. The tailpiece plays a crucial role in the overall functionality of a sink system by ensuring efficient water flow and preventing backups.


What is the purpose of a sink drain trap and how does it contribute to the overall functionality of a sink system?

The purpose of a sink drain trap is to prevent sewer gases from entering the home and to catch debris that could clog the plumbing system. It contributes to the overall functionality of a sink system by ensuring proper drainage and maintaining a healthy environment in the home.

What is the purpose of a drain tailpiece in a plumbing system?

The purpose of a drain tailpiece in a plumbing system is to connect the sink drain to the P-trap, allowing water and waste to flow out of the sink and into the sewer system.
